#include <DescriptorPool.hpp>
Definition at line 17 of file DescriptorPool.hpp.
◆ DescriptorPool() [1/4]
lug::Graphics::Vulkan::API::DescriptorPool::DescriptorPool |
( |
| ) |
|
|
default |
◆ DescriptorPool() [2/4]
lug::Graphics::Vulkan::API::DescriptorPool::DescriptorPool |
( |
const DescriptorPool & |
| ) |
|
|
delete |
◆ DescriptorPool() [3/4]
lug::Graphics::Vulkan::API::DescriptorPool::DescriptorPool |
( |
DescriptorPool && |
DescriptorPool | ) |
|
◆ ~DescriptorPool()
lug::Graphics::Vulkan::API::DescriptorPool::~DescriptorPool |
( |
| ) |
|
◆ DescriptorPool() [4/4]
lug::Graphics::Vulkan::API::DescriptorPool::DescriptorPool |
( |
VkDescriptorPool |
descriptorPool, |
|
|
const Device * |
device |
|
) |
| |
|
explicitprivate |
◆ operator=() [1/2]
◆ operator=() [2/2]
◆ operator VkDescriptorPool()
lug::Graphics::Vulkan::API::DescriptorPool::operator VkDescriptorPool |
( |
| ) |
const |
|
inlineexplicit |
◆ destroy()
void lug::Graphics::Vulkan::API::DescriptorPool::destroy |
( |
| ) |
|
◆ Builder::DescriptorPool
◆ _descriptorPool
VkDescriptorPool lug::Graphics::Vulkan::API::DescriptorPool::_descriptorPool {VK_NULL_HANDLE} |
|
private |
◆ _device
const Device* lug::Graphics::Vulkan::API::DescriptorPool::_device {nullptr} |
|
private |
The documentation for this class was generated from the following files: